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16052918 3330367611 6603
04391679224 4669
04391679224 4669
7403599379 383802 90
All about undefined
Interested in learning more?
04391679224 4669
7403599379 383802 90
See more
00759392961 33
9755184 63 9684035 35671
See more
032345253 19153225 31952
0655721242 669076726 706 78037
See more